A former Tottenham player, David Bentley, recently gained attention after entering Mikel Arteta’s office at the Emirates Stadium to celebrate Tottenham’s Europa League victory. Bentley, known for his playful antics, couldn’t resist poking fun at Arsenal’s lack of trophies. He participated in a charity soccer match at the Emirates, playing alongside Callum Best and Jeremy Lynch.
Other participants included social media influencers, YouTubers, and reality TV stars. Bentley, famous for a previous prank on Tottenham’s former manager Harry Redknapp, was up to his old tricks again. He enlisted two former Britain’s Got Talent contestants, Woody and Kleiny, to help him sneak into Arteta’s office.
Once inside, Bentley humorously thanked Arteta for “leaving a beer” and grabbed two bottles of Camden Hells beer from the fridge, a sponsor of Arsenal. He then performed a celebratory dance with “Winners 2025” written on his Tottenham shirt, singing a song beloved by Spurs fans.
Bentley’s actions were particularly provocative given his background with Arsenal. He was part of Arsenal’s academy but only played nine senior games before joining Blackburn Rovers and eventually Tottenham in 2008. Despite initial promise, his career at Tottenham was marred by injuries.
The video of Bentley’s stunt was shared by Woody and Kleiny on social media but was later removed upon request, though not before being widely circulated by others. The duo explained on Instagram that they were asked to take down the footage.
